Toronto’s getting a daylight saving skating experience with free coffee

The Bentway is honouring its final day of skating in Toronto, which so happens to be daylight saving time, with a whimsical coffee and pyjama party on ice.

On March 8, 2026, the beloved skating destination will welcome skaters one last time before it wraps up for the season. But before it does that, The Bentway will give back with Daylight Saving Skate.

What to expect at The Bentway

“Ease into the time change with a hot coffee and a final celebratory glide along the skate trail before we say goodbye to the ice for the season,” shares organizers.

“Daylight saving steals an hour of sleep, and we’re giving it back the best way we know how: on the ice.”

Everyone is invited to reset their internal clocks with some free, fresh coffee brews and an extra hour of skating. Oh, and pyjamas are encouraged.

The Skate Trail will open an hour earlier, starting right at 11 a.m. “Come bundled up, move at your own pace, and savour the longer days ahead,” shares The Bentway.

Skate rentals will also be available.

Whether you’re sporting a onesie, a matching set, or even bathrobes under your parkas, it’s all welcome.

Get ready to say goodbye to winter and welcome an extra hour of sunlight this weekend.

The Bentway Skating Trail – Daylight Saving Skate

When: March 8, 2026
Time: 11 a.m. (coffee available while supplies last)
Where: 250 Fort York Blvd.
Cost: Free admission
